Lyn Ford Visits HLSD to Celebrate Black History Month
Thank you to Affrilachian Storyteller, Lyn Ford, for visiting multiple buildings in our district this month to celebrate Black History Month. 

Lyn Ford is best known for what she describes as "Home-Fried Tales" - folktale adaptations, spooky tales, and original stories rooted in Lyn's family's multicultural Afrilachian storytelling traditions. Lyn's stories are enriched with calls and response, choral response, rhythm and rhyme.
